Updated on February 5, 2022 11:06 AM

Our Top Picks for Python Hosting in 2022

Explore quality Python Hosting providers with DDoS Protection, HackScan Protection, and developer-friendly add-ons, such as FTP/SFTP support, free SSH Access, and an SSL certificate.


Top 10 Python Hosting Providers

  • 1
    A2 Hosting review Incl. 1802 user reviews
    Python Hosting With 99.9% Uptime Commitment And 20x Faster Turbo Server Option
    Industry-Leading Python Hosting On Blazing Fast Swiftservers
    24/7/365 Guru Crew Support Via Live Chat, Phone, Or Email
    • Space 100.04 MB – Unlimited
    • RAM 1 GB – 128 GB
    $0.00 / mo
    1 Coupons
    Visit Site
  • 2
    LWS review Incl. 1546 user reviews
    Pre-Installed and Ready to Use VPS Servers With Root SSH Access and Optional VPN Activation
    100% Secure Data Centers In France With Minimum 99.9% Uptime Guaranteed
    Free Domain Name, The Latest PHP and MySQL Versions, Anti-DDoS, Control Panels, 24/7 Supervision, GTI, and Possible Outsourcin
    • Space 40 GB – Unlimited
    • RAM 2 GB – 12 GB
    $1.70 / mo
    Visit Site
  • 3
    FastComet review Incl. 1420 user reviews
    Python Cloud Hosting For Creative Developers On An SSD-Only Cloud
    Easily Transfer Your Python App Hosted With Another Provider To A FastComet Python Hosting Plan
    Unlimited 24/7 Priority Support
    • Space 15 GB – Unlimited
    • RAM 2 GB – 32 GB
    $0.00 / mo
    3 Coupons
    Visit Site
  • 4
    ProHoster review Incl. 1251 user reviews
    14-Day Free Trial
    Unlimited Domains for Free, Free DDoS Protection, a Free Website Builder, and a Free SSL Certificate
    300+ Programs with Automatic Installation (one-click)
    • Space 10 GB – Unlimited
    • RAM 512 MB – 64 GB
    $1.30 / mo
    4 Coupons
    Visit Site
  • 5
    Hostwinds review Incl. 1154 user reviews
    Enterprise-Level Solutions with Personal-Level Support
    Fully-Redundant Servers with 2N Redundancy Standards and T1 Carriers
    Award-Winning Web Hosting services suitable for Personal and Business use
    • Space Unlimited
    • RAM 1 GB – 96 GB
    $0.00 / mo
    2 Coupons
    Visit Site
  • 6
    GoogieHost review Incl. 679 user reviews
    Free Web Hosting Service - No Credit Card Required
    NVMe SSD-Based Web Hosting with Premium SitePad Website Builder and a Free Let's Encrypt SSL Certificate
    Free cPanel, Free Subdomain, Softaculous Auto Installer, and 24/7 Customer Support
    • Space 1 GB – Unlimited
    • RAM 2 GB
    $0.00 / mo
    Visit Site
  • 7
    ChemiCloud review Incl. 537 user reviews
    Python Hosting Plans With Free SSL Certificates, One-Click Installs, And Daily Backups
    Worldwide Server Locations, LiteSpeed Cache, And Free Cloudflare CDN
    24/7 Python Assistance
    • Space 20 GB – 640 GB
    • RAM 4 GB – 32 GB
    $2.98 / mo
    1 Coupons
    Visit Site
  • 8
    Hostripples review Incl. 526 user reviews
    A 30-Day Money-Back Guarantee and 24/7 Customer Support
    A One-Click Installer with more than 400 PHP Scripts
    Free RVSiteBuilder, a Free Domain Name, and Free Data Migration
    • Space 20 GB – Unlimited
    • RAM 512 MB – 16 GB
    $1.33 / mo
    Visit Site
  • 9
    VHosting Solution review Incl. 453 user reviews
    Up-To-Date Hardware, Redundant DNS Network, No Hidden Limits
    Full Transparency With Renewal Prices Equal To The Initial Purchase Rates
    Over Ten Years On The Market, Thousands Of Positive Reviews, 24h Professional Support, and A Money-Back Guarantee
    • Space 6 GB – 4.5 TB
    • RAM 1 GB – 64 GB
    $2.41 / mo
    Visit Site
  • 10
    is*hosting review Incl. 453 user reviews
    Certified and Reliable Datacenters, High-Quality Services, and Only the Most Advanced Technologies
    Privacy & Confidentiality, Anonymous Payment Methods, and The Ability to Order Through VPN/TOR
    No Long-Term Contracts and Legendary Technical Support Always on The Client's Side
    • Space 20 GB – Unlimited
    • RAM 1 GB – 64 GB
    $5.00 / mo
    Visit Site
Didn't find the right hosting provider for your needs? Search and discover the best hosting company for you from 5,969 brands on our website.
Written by , Posted on , Updated on .


Do These Python Hosting Providers Truly Hook Me Up With What I Need?

Suppose you are running a Python-based website and web application. In that case, you might need to look at Python-specific web hosting providers to ensure that you have the highest level of performance and availability.

There are many options out there, so you will need to consider factors such as the price, the uptime, the customer support, the policy of modules, and the support in terms of specific processes. You will also need to check the version of the interpreter that they offer.

Question: What are Modules in Python?

Answer: In Python, Modules are files with the “.py” extension which contain Python code that can be imported inside another Python program. You can look at them as code libraries or files that contain a set of functions that you want to have in your application or website.

Mind Map of factors of the Best Web Hosting Python services

To help you narrow down your choice, HostAdvice experts have reviewed as well as compiled the list of the best Python web server hosting services, so you won’t have to spend too much time deciding which one to pick. You can pick any of the options listed here, and the chances are high that you will have quite a solid experience.

Nevertheless, knowing what to look for will allow you to pick the best possible option when it comes to picking the right Python server hosting provider, so let us dive deep into Python web hosting and see what you will need. So if you are curious as to exactly how to host a Python website through a specialized Python hosting provider, this is the perfect guide for you.

What to Look for When Choosing the Best Web Hosting Python Services:

  • Framework Support
  • Modules Support
  • Persistent Processing
  • Dedicated Server Maintenance
  • Python Versions That Are Supported List
  • 1-Click Auto-Installer Scripts
  • Root Access
  • Support for HTTP and MIME out of The Box

man let out many snakes from the bag

Note: Most modern operating systems use a 64-bit edition of Python by default, however, Windows users can run 32-bit editions of Python.

I hear You, But Like, Who Is Python Hosting Actually Meant For?

For People Who Are Building a Website in Python – if you are planning to, or already running your website or web app that is written in Python, it is important that you seek out a web hosting solution that specializes in this technology. As a primary server-side scripting language, Python requires the servers that it is interacting with to have a Python interpreter in order to load all of the applications when the users request them. If the hosting provider does not specialize in Python, you will need to ensure that the interpreter matches Python’s specific version.

People Who Require a Lot of Processing Power Python by itself is a resource-heavy programming language. In fact, in order to protect the pooled resources of shared plans, many host Python plans will tend to only offer you cloud, VPS Hosting, or dedicated server options. These plans, by default, come with a higher price tag associated with them. However, they provide you with the ability to run any Python script without worrying that you might unintentionally take down, or decelerate a server that you are sharing with others. Your website or app might lag as well, assuming it does not have the resources that it needs available to it, at the time that it needs them. This is why shared hosting plans are not recommended.

People Who Prefer Pay-per-Usage Schemes – There are certain hosting providers out there that provide you with a pay-per-usage option, which means that you will end up paying what your server actually ends up using in terms of resources. For example, in traditional hosting providers, you’d pay a fixed sum for fixed resources, and if you use only 20% or 30% of those resources, you would not receive a discount or get any money back. Through this scheme, you will only ever pay for what you are actually using.

People Who Love to Program in Python – A hosting provider that specializes in Python will provide you with a wide array of Python coding frameworks, such as Django, Web2Py, and Pylon to name a few. This means that you are not limited as to exactly what you can do, and you will not need to side-load anything by yourself.

Note: More and more people with no programming background like accountants and scientists have been adopting Python for a variety of everyday tasks, like organizing finances.

boy programming on a computer (meme)

But Wait a Moment, What Will I Actually Get Through Picking Python Web Hosting Over Anything Else Out There?

  • A Pre-Configured Python Software Environment – When you opt-in to use Python hosting, you will not need to waste any time when it comes to installing software on your server, or setting things up through a different web application framework. The Python host you end up picking, assuming it specializes in Python, will set things up for you which will allow you to dive into your coding with ease. This will save you a lot of time and energy and is one of the main benefits of going this route.
  • Access To The Resources You Need – As mentioned, no matter what kind of website or app you will use, you will need a lot more resources than the ones that are available in most shared hosting plans. As such, you need to ensure that you are using a web hosting provider that will allow you to scale things up, and increase your RAM, CPU, SSD Storage, and Bandwidth with ease.
  • An Optimized Server for the Python Version You decide to run – Python host will tend to offer multiple versions of Python that are supported, as well as have the most up-to-date modules available to you so you can ensure that your script runs the way you intend it to. Hosting providers that do not specialize in Python could be lacking in this department.
    Question: Do I need Apache to run Python?

    Answer: Yes, you will need Apache for performance.

computer upgrade animation (meme)

Cutting the “Fat”, What You’ll Actually Need to Search For At Python Hosting Service Providers

Does the Server Allow For Fast Page Load Speeds? – Python can slow things down, as it is a resource-heavy programming language, and you do not want to slow it down further through any unrelated server issues. This is why you need to ensure that the web hosting service provider you end up picking will utilize tools that can speed up the load times, and an example for this would be a CDN, as well as provide you with the choice of multiple data centers as well as caching features.

Which Python Versions Are Available For You to Run? – There are multiple versions of Python that developers are utilizing on a worldwide scale. Obviously, not everyone will always upgrade to the latest version, and as such, you need to ensure that the web hosting provider you end up picking can support each of these versions with ease.

How Many Python Application Frameworks Does It Support? – There are multiple Python frameworks, and each of them works differently, depending on the scale of the project itself. You will need to analyze and see if you will need a micro framework or a full-stack framework, and ensure that the hosting provider you end up picking supports your needs.

Does the Support Team Know How to Assist You With Python Webhosting? – If you are going to pick a hosting provider that specializes in Python, you need to ensure that the support team understands how Python works as well, so they can support you and actually answer all of the questions you have, as well as help you resolve any of the issues that you end up running into.

Currently Top 3 Python Hosting Companies


Is Python Available On Shared Hosting Plans?

Python is fully available to install on just about any hosting plan, however, shared hosting plans are simply not recommended due to the fact that they do not have the resources required in order to efficiently run your website or web app.

What Is PIP Software?

PIP stands for the Python installer Package, and it provides a seamless interface through which you can install the various Python Modules. It is a command-line-based tool that searches for packages online. The perfect Python hosting solution will have these pre-installed or at least have the PIP pre-installed.

What Versions of Python Are Supported?

You need to ensure that the web hosting provider you end up choosing supports multiple versions of Python. Some of the most widely used ones are Python 3.8.1, Python 3.7.6, Python 3.6.10, Python 3.5.9, Python 3.5.8, Python 2.7.17, Python 3.7.5, Python 3.8.0, Python 3.7.4, Python 3.6.9, and Python 3.9.0.

Does Python Allow You to Program in a Structured Style?

Python allows you to code in a structured as well as object-oriented style. You need to ensure that the web hosting solution you end up using will support both styles.

What Server is Best for Python?

A Dedicated or Virtual Private Server is the perfect choice when it comes to hosting Python, ideally one that is fully scalable.

Web Hosting in Compare:

Select at least 1 more company to compare
Cancel Compare